The Nobel Prize in Physiology or Medicine 1947 was divided, one half jointly to Carl Ferdinand Cori and Gerty Theresa Cori Radnitz for their discovery of the course of the catalytic conversion of glycogen and the other half to Bernardo Alberto Houssay for his discovery of the part played by the hormone of the anterior pituitary lobe in the metabolism of sugar.

Q: Why did Gerty Theresa Cori Radnitz win The Nobel Prize in Physiology or Medicine in 1947?
